Food To Enhance Your Diet 

Here is a list of foods that will help you to stay healthy and enhance your diet. 

1. Green Leafy Vegetables 

Green leafy vegetables are high in vitamins and minerals. Moreover, they are a rich source of antioxidants, which help to boost immunity and fibre content that aids digestion. You can consume spinach, kale, fenugreek, carrot greens, radish greens, cauliflower green and many more.

2. Fish 

Fish contains omega-3 fatty acids like sardines, mackerel, tuna etc., which assist in lowering the chances of heart issues by reducing the bad cholesterol and increasing the good cholesterol in the body. 

3. Nuts 

Nuts are rich in micronutrients which boost immunity and also have good protein. Therefore, they are considered best for people on a diet. Moreover, some nuts like walnuts and almonds contain MUFA, which curbs the chances of heart issues.

4. Whole Grains 

Whole grains are rich in fibre, good carbs and phytonutrients, which can lower the excess sugar levels for diabetic patients. Moreover,  by combining 2 or 3 whole grain flours, we can get extra nutrients that will enhance the quality of the diet.

5. Oils 

Some oils like olive, canola, sunflower and cottonseed are suitable for the body as they contain both MUFA and PUFA, which are significant for lowering bad cholesterol and promoting a healthy heart. Also, these oils contain polyphenols which act as antioxidants and fight free radicals from the body. 

6. Curd / Yoghurt 

It is an excellent combination of protein and calcium. Moreover, yoghurt is probiotic which aids digestion and keeps the gut microflora healthy. 

7. Legumes and Pulses 

Legumes and pulses are rich in fibre and proteins. These are best for vegetarians and vegans to get the necessary proteins. Studies have shown that they can help reduce the risk of heart disease. 

8. Fruits and Berries 

Fruits and berries are rich in vitamins, minerals and potassium. Therefore, consuming them directly without hassle can provide extra nutrition if added regularly to the diet. 

9. Dairy Products

Dairy products like paneer, milk and cheese contain calcium which helps to strengthen the bones and provide fat. However, they are easy to digest if consumed in controlled portions. 

10. Seeds 

Seeds like flax seeds, chia and pumpkin seeds are great for health. They help to boost mood and promote better functioning of the organs.

Food Consumption According To Age 

Age is a huge factor to be considered to include and exclude certain foods from the diet. Therefore, let us discuss all the age groups and what should be added to enhance the diet.  

1. 20 to 40 Years Of Age 

At this age, there is a lot more requirement of nutrients in the body to manage body functions as people tend to work hard either in education or in professional space. So the need for nutrients also increases as their body goes through a lot of hard work.

2. 40 to 60 Years of Age 

Intake of calcium is required as this is the age when osteoporosis takes place. Other than that, good fats are also needed to provide energy and absorption of specific vitamins, which boost immunity.

3. More Than 60 Years of Age 

As the body ages, more foods rich in fibre, vitamins, and micronutrients are required by the body. As the body slows down, functioning and nutrient deficiency occurs. Therefore, consuming beans, legumes, fruits, milk, and nuts is essential to include in the diet.

3. How is National Nutritional week celebrated in India?  

National nutrition week is celebrated by proposing initiatives on nutrient deficiencies like vitamins, irons and many more. 

4. At what number does India stand for Global Hunger Index 2021? 

India stands at 101 amongst 116 countries.

5. When was the first National Nutrition week celebrated in India?

The first National Nutrition week was celebrated in 1982.
